diff options
author | Rafael Espindola <rafael.espindola@gmail.com> | 2014-06-24 22:45:16 +0000 |
---|---|---|
committer | Rafael Espindola <rafael.espindola@gmail.com> | 2014-06-24 22:45:16 +0000 |
commit | 4186005edc9a083e568eab8df308ff647b84c3de (patch) | |
tree | 1fa332a6a6e52fa4832275a2332c68999eead3b8 /test/CodeGen/Mips/mips16ex.ll | |
parent | 95eb45c5d94bfe9360ffc021697a50c6cf8c08cd (diff) | |
download | llvm-4186005edc9a083e568eab8df308ff647b84c3de.tar.gz llvm-4186005edc9a083e568eab8df308ff647b84c3de.tar.bz2 llvm-4186005edc9a083e568eab8df308ff647b84c3de.tar.xz |
Print a=b as an assignment.
In assembly the expression a=b is parsed as an assignment, so it should be
printed as one.
This remove a truly horrible hack for producing a label with "a=.". It would
be used by codegen but would never be reached by the asm parser. Sorry I
missed this when it was first committed.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@211639 91177308-0d34-0410-b5e6-96231b3b80d8
Diffstat (limited to 'test/CodeGen/Mips/mips16ex.ll')
-rw-r--r-- | test/CodeGen/Mips/mips16ex.ll |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/test/CodeGen/Mips/mips16ex.ll b/test/CodeGen/Mips/mips16ex.ll index ecb30b5c63..a1a9919159 100644 --- a/test/CodeGen/Mips/mips16ex.ll +++ b/test/CodeGen/Mips/mips16ex.ll @@ -1,6 +1,8 @@ ; RUN: llc -march=mipsel -mcpu=mips16 -relocation-model=pic -O3 < %s | FileCheck %s -check-prefix=16 -;16: $eh_func_begin0=. +;16: .cfi_personality +;16-NEXT: [[TMP:.*]]: +;16-NEXT: $eh_func_begin0 = ([[TMP]]) @.str = private unnamed_addr constant [7 x i8] c"hello\0A\00", align 1 @_ZTIi = external constant i8* @.str1 = private unnamed_addr constant [15 x i8] c"exception %i \0A\00", align 1 |